Stevens 411 Upland Sporter

Non Restricted

The RCMP Firearms Reference Table records the Stevens 411 Upland Sporter (multi-barrel, chambered in 12 Gauge, 20 Gauge, .410 Bore, made in Russia) as Non Restricted in Canada, under FRN 121594.

Common questions

Is the Stevens 411 Upland Sporter restricted in Canada?

The RCMP Firearms Reference Table records the Stevens 411 Upland Sporter (multi-barrel, chambered in 12 Gauge, 20 Gauge, .410 Bore, made in Russia) as Non Restricted in Canada, under FRN 121594. Classification attaches to the specific firearm rather than the model name, so variants with a different barrel length, overall length or action can carry a different class. Confirm the record matches the firearm in front of you, and verify with the RCMP Canadian Firearms Program before any transfer.

What licence do I need to buy a Stevens 411 Upland Sporter?

A valid non-restricted PAL, which the seller must verify before the firearm changes hands. No registration is required for individuals, and the firearm can be shipped by a carrier that accepts firearms.

What is FRN 121594?

FRN 121594 is the Firearm Reference Number the RCMP assigns to this Stevens 411 Upland Sporter record in the Firearms Reference Table. Quoting the FRN is the unambiguous way to identify a firearm in a transfer, a registration or an import, because model names are reused across variants that are not classified alike.
